Lace Back - Little Black Dress

Well this weekend I went to my first wedding for a high school friend, a best friend at that!  I really want to know where the time has gone, I swear we were just walking across the stage at graduation.  Well I knew this was going to be a special night but I really had no idea what I was going to wear.  Certainly an important occasion but I didn't want to spend a fortune on a dress.  I hate buying things you only really wear once!

As I was running through the racks at Marshalls last weekend I found it!  From the front it looks like a simple little black dress, or as my sister calls it, a LBD.  It has the stylish peplum ruffle around the waist.  To my surprise, when I flipped it over I noticed the full lace back!  It's hard to tell from the pictures, but the lace had a gold tint to it. I immediately fell in love and knew this was perfect for the occasion!  



I wore shoes that were delicate with gold rings running from a strap at my toes to my ankle.  For jewelry I kept it light with a thin layered gold necklace and four simple bangles.  When wearing a dress like this, you want to keep it classy and let the dress do the talking.  There is no need to layer on the accessories, as the dress itself is the statement.













What to do with your hair with a dress like this?  First things first, make sure the back is uncovered!  Any soft updo would do the trick, I went with a curly ponytail and strand around the elastic. 












I know you are all probably wondering how much it was - of course it was a great fashion find, $19.99!!

Tip: Keep your fashion finds looking classy, wearing all kinds of bold accessories would have turned this look into tacky in a second.
